Ingredients: 2 cups chicken (cubed and cooked), 2 cups shredded mozzarella (divided), 1/2 cup shredded Parmesan cheese, 1 cup chopped spinach, 1 can of artichoke hearts (drained), I can of diced tomatoes (drained), 2 tsp. Basil, 2 tsp. Oregano, 1 tsp. Garlic Powder, 2 (8 oz) packages of cream cheese, 1/2 cup milk, 12 lasagna noodles (cooked).
Directions: Mix chicken, 1 cup of mozzarella cheese and Parmesan cheese, tomatoes, artichokes and spinach in a dish.
In a separate bowl mix cream cheese and milk together until smooth. Add basil, oregano and garlic powder.
Spread enough of the cream cheese mixture into a 9 X 13 baking pan to just cover the bottom. The place a layer of noodles, with a layer of chicken mixture on top and a layer of the cream cheese mixture on top. Continue layering until all ingredients are used. Sprinkle remaining mozzarella cheese on top and bake at 350 degrees for 25 minutes.
